Digital Transformation of Maritime Freight Market Segmentation and Market Companies
Segments
- On the basis of solutions, the digital transformation of maritime freight market can be segmented into solutions for container tracking, inventory management, warehouse automation, and others. Container tracking solutions are in high demand as they help optimize supply chain operations by providing real-time visibility of cargo movements. Inventory management solutions are also essential for efficient inventory control and minimizing operational costs. Warehouse automation solutions are increasingly being adopted to streamline warehouse operations and meet the growing demand for e-commerce logistics.
- By deployment mode, the market can be categorized into cloud-based and on-premises solutions. Cloud-based solutions are preferred for their scalability, flexibility, and cost-effectiveness. On-premises solutions, on the other hand, offer greater control and security over data, which is crucial for sensitive maritime freight operations.
- Based on organization size, the digital transformation of maritime freight market can be classified into small and medium-sized enterprises (SMEs) and large enterprises. SMEs are increasingly adopting digital transformation solutions to stay competitive in the market and enhance their operational efficiency. Large enterprises, with their higher budget allocations, are investing in advanced digital technologies to automate and optimize their maritime freight processes.

The digital transformation of maritime freight market is undergoing a significant shift as industry players leverage technological advancements to optimize operations and meet the evolving needs of the supply chain ecosystem. One key trend that is reshaping the market landscape is the increasing focus on sustainability and environmental performance. Maritime freight companies are exploring digital solutions that enable them to reduce carbon emissions, improve fuel efficiency, and enhance overall sustainability practices. This shift towards green logistics is being driven by regulatory pressures, consumer preferences for eco-friendly transportation, and the need to build a more resilient and environmentally conscious supply chain.
Another emerging trend in the digital transformation of maritime freight market is the integration of blockchain technology to enhance transparency, security, and traceability in shipping processes. Blockchain enables secure data sharing among stakeholders, minimizes fraud and errors, and simplifies complex documentation processes. By leveraging blockchain, maritime freight companies can improve visibility into the flow of goods, enhance asset tracking capabilities, and streamline trade processes across borders. This technology has the potential to revolutionize the way maritime freight transactions are conducted, leading to greater efficiency, trust, and collaboration in the industry.
Furthermore, the rise of predictive analytics and AI-driven solutions is empowering maritime freight companies to make data-driven decisions, forecast demand more accurately, optimize routes, and anticipate operational disruptions. By harnessing the power of data analytics, companies can proactively identify risks, streamline processes, and enhance overall operational performance. Predictive maintenance solutions powered by AI algorithms are also gaining traction in the maritime sector, enabling companies to reduce downtime, extend the lifespan of assets, and lower maintenance costs.
Moreover, digital twins are emerging as a game-changer in the digital transformation of maritime freight market, allowing companies to create virtual replicas of physical assets and operations. By simulating different scenarios, testing strategies, and optimizing processes in a virtual environment, companies can improve efficiency, mitigate risks, and drive innovation in their operations. Digital twins enable real-time monitoring, predictive modeling, and remote management of assets, providing a comprehensive view of the entire supply chain ecosystem.
In conclusion, the digital transformation of maritime freight market is witnessing a rapid evolution driven by sustainability initiatives, blockchain integration, predictive analytics, AI solutions, and digital twins. Companies that embrace these technologies and innovations will gain a competitive edge, enhance operational resilience, and meet the increasing demands for efficiency, transparency, and sustainability in the maritime industry.
